Well, there are few things to discuss (spoilers):

1. At the end of Thieves Guild questline you are selling your soul to Noctrurnal.
2. Souls of Dark Brotherhood members belongs to Sithis.
3. If you are werewolf (Companions) you are going to the Hircine's Hunting Grounds after death.
4. In fact you are Dragonborn, so Akatosh would like to take your soul back.
5. You can become champion of many deadric princes in Skyrim, I think, that they would also pretend to claim your poor soul.

What do you think about that, would they make a "small" war, or just Akatosh will get you, becouse he's the most powerfull. Of course they can just give up, or spilt your soul into parts :smile:, or... play paper-stone-sisscors.

Yes, souls in TES universe are different from the way we think of souls in the Judeo-Christian culture. Our culture tends to view the soul as the essence of the "self" while the metaphysics of TES undermines the concept of self as its central theme. "Self" in TES is an illusion.
